WebbBottom-up estimating is a technique in project management for estimating the costs or duration of projects and parts of a project (PMBOK®, 6 th edition, ch. 6.4.2.5, ch. 7.2.2.4). The term bottom-up estimating gives a hint about the underlying concept: costs, durations or resource requirements are estimated at a very granular level.

Webb20 juni 2024 · The PBS is also sometimes called the functional breakdown structure (FBS) since it organizes the system or product by functionality. The top level of the PBS contains the system or product name, followed by a list of major functions. Each major function contains several lower-level functions, which can be further decomposed as needed. Webb15 aug. 2024 · 1. NOT KNOWING WHEN TO STOP • It’s important to stop working on your WBS when it gets to a suitable level. The activities described on it should feel as if they would last about a week, maybe longer if your project is running over a year or more. • Conversely, you don’t want to stop before you get to that level.
